This 3D pie chart showcases the job market trends in the UK for various HR roles, emphasizing their respective demand. The data reflects the industry's growing need for professionals with specialized skill sets in different HR areas. The HR Business Partner role leads the pack with 25% of the demand. Their responsibility for aligning business objectives with employees' needs and managing organizational changes is vital in times of crisis. Talent Acquisition Specialists follow closely with 20% of the demand. As organizations adapt to crisis situations, these experts are essential in sourcing, interviewing, and hiring the right talent to support business continuity. With a 15% share, Learning & Development Managers play a critical role in preparing the workforce for changes by designing and implementing training programs. This ensures that employees have the necessary skills to navigate crises effectively. Compensation & Benefits Analysts and Diversity & Inclusion Managers both account for 10% of the demand in the UK market. Analysts ensure fair pay and benefits during crisis situations, while Diversity & Inclusion Managers maintain a positive and inclusive work environment, fostering resilience and unity in diverse teams. Lastly, HRIS Analysts (10%) and Employee Relations Specialists (10%) complete the list of in-demand HR roles. HRIS Analysts facilitate the efficient management of HR data, while Employee Relations Specialists handle workplace conflicts and maintain positive employee-employer relationships during challenging times.
